Steven P. Kent has served on our Board of Directors since June 2019, and serves as the chair of the Risk Committee, and as a member of the Audit, Compensation, and Governance and Nominating Committees. Mr. Kent also serves on the board of directors of Byline Bank and serves as the chair of the Risk and Trust Committees, and as a member of the Audit, Executive Credit, Compensation, Governance and Nominating, and ALCO Committees of Byline Bank. Mr. Kent served as Vice Chairman and a managing director of the Financial Services Group at Piper Sandler Companies (formerly Piper Jaffray Companies) until January 2021, where he focused on merger and acquisition advisory and capital market transactions for financial services companies. Prior to joining Piper Sandler in October 2015, Mr. Kent co-founded and served as President of River Branch Capital from March 2011 through its sale to Piper Jaffray in September 2015. At River Branch, Mr. Kent advised client banking companies on capital management, equity recapitalizations, merger & acquisition transactions and private equity executions where, in select instances, affiliates of River Branch acted as an investing principal. From August 1998 through March 2011, Mr. Kent was a managing director and co-head of the Chicago office of Keefe, Bruyette & Woods ( KBW ), a boutique investment bank and broker-dealer that specializes in the financial services sector. Prior to joining KBW, Mr. Kent was an executive officer with Robert W. Baird and Co. ( Baird ) for 16 years, where he led strategic planning, fixed income capital markets and structured finance, and headed the firm s Financial Services Investment Banking practice. From 1973 to 1982, Mr. Kent was an executive officer at two Midwestern multibank holding companies focusing on strategic planning, bank and trust investment portfolio management, asset and liability management, and commercial and government guaranteed credit origination. From 2012 to 2018, Mr. Kent served as a director and member of the finance and nominating committees of IFF, a Midwest-focused Community Development Financial Institution ( CDFI ) certified by the U.S. Department of the Treasury, which serves as a mission-driven lender, real estate consultant and developer that helps communities thrive by creating opportunities for low-income communities and people with disabilities. In January 2019, Mr. Kent was elected to join the board of the Community Reinvestment Fund, USA ( CRF ), a CDFI with a mission-driven strategy headquartered in Minneapolis. In 2020, Mr. Kent was elected to be a founding director of Ignify Technologies, a Public Benefit Corporation formed by CRF to commercialize its Spark Technology Platform to integrate and digitize the small business lending ecosystem. In July 2023, Mr. Kent was elected to serve as an independent director of Ampersand, Inc., a privately held financial technology company.
